Understanding Payroll Software: How It Can Simplify Your HR Processes
As a business owner or manager, you know that human resources is a vital component of your company’s success. Yet, it can be a daunting challenge to efficiently manage HR processes while also overseeing day-to-day business operations. Luckily, tools like payroll software are at your disposal to simplify and optimize your HR processes, enabling you to allocate your time to other crucial elements of your business.
One of the main functions of payroll software is to automate the payroll process, ensuring that your employees are paid accurately and on time. This software can also assist with other HR functions, such as time and attendance tracking, tax compliance, and benefits administration. By utilizing payroll software, you can minimize the possibility of mistakes and inaccuracies that may arise when managing these processes manually.
One of the primary benefits of using payroll software is increased efficiency and accuracy. The software automates tasks like calculating payroll and monitoring employee hours, saving time and lowering the likelihood of errors. This also implies that you can concentrate more time and energy on other aspects of your business.
In addition to streamlining HR processes, payroll software can also provide valuable insights and data about your workforce. For instance, you may use the software to evaluate labor expenses and detect patterns in staff hours, providing you with information to make better decisions when it comes to managing your workforce.
Payroll software can also automate a variety of payroll-related duties, such as tax calculations and filing. This can save you time and minimize the possibility of errors, which can be expensive and time-consuming to rectify.
Payroll software can also integrate with other HR tools and software, such as time and attendance systems. This can aid in the further streamlining of your HR processes and guarantee that all of your employee data is stored in a single, centralized location.
When choosing payroll software, there are several factors to consider. First and foremost, you need to ensure that the software is capable of handling the specific needs of your business, such as the number of employees you have and the complexity of your payroll.
Additionally, you should take into account the level of support and customer service provided by the software vendor. In the event of an issue or problem, it is essential to have a reliable support team that can assist you in resolving the issue quickly and efficiently.
Security is another crucial factor to consider when selecting payroll software. Payroll data includes sensitive information like social security numbers and bank account details, making it essential to choose software that provides strong security measures to safeguard this data. When searching for payroll software, look for features such as data encryption, multi-factor authentication, and regular backups to prevent data breaches and loss.
Aside from security features, it is also important to consider the user-friendliness of the payroll software. The payroll software should be simple to use, with clear instructions and user-friendly interfaces that enable you to access the required information quickly and easily. Training and support should also be available to ensure that you can use the software effectively.
